Eight months after the events of Prodigy , June has reinstated herself within the Republic’s elite military circles, working closely with the new Elector Primo, Anden. Meanwhile, Day has transitioned from a street rebel to a national hero, though he suffers from a terminal neurological condition caused by past Republic experiments.
Before diving into the finale, one must appreciate the journey of June Iparis and Day. The trilogy set in a futuristic, fractured United States—now the Republic and the Colonies—follows two teenagers from opposite sides of the tracks. June is a prodigy of the Republic’s military elite, while Day is the nation’s most wanted criminal. Their paths collide in a tale of vengeance that evolves into a desperate fight for the truth.

Champion asks a fundamental question: What do you owe your country when your country has broken you? Both June and Day have lost their families to the Republic's cruelty, yet they choose to save it from external destruction.
